National mesothelioma law firms have the knowledge and resources to manage cases across the nation. This is a boon for veterans who were exposed to asbestos in several states. In reality, they have successfully obtained billions of dollars in settlements and verdicts on behalf of their clients.

For instance, Weitz & Luxenberg has secured more than $8.5 billion for asbestos victims and their families since its founding since 1999. Simmons Hanly Conroy has recovered more than $250 million for asbestos victims including a mesothelioma patient from Indiana and the first-ever multimillion-dollar settlement against Ford Motor Company for a mesothelioma case filed by a U.S. Navy veteran.

A mesothelioma law firm will listen to your story, collect records, and review all available options for compensation. Once the firm has a clear understanding of your case they will determine the extent to which you were exposed. This may include going through your military records or your work history, contacting former co-workers and asking you about asbestos products you handled. They will then discover who made these products and what exposure you were exposed to.

Once they have all the required details, the mesothelioma lawyers will start a lawsuit in your name. They will take into consideration the legal jurisdiction, settlement history, and state laws in order to make sure they're filing in the appropriate forum. They will also prepare all the paperwork necessary for the lawsuit including medical records, documents to demonstrate your exposure, and other important evidence.

After a mesothelioma lawsuit is filed, your lawyers will examine the responsible asbestos companies and begin pursuing compensation for you. This process is referred to as discovery, and it allows your mesothelioma attorney to present written questions (interrogatories) and oral evidence to defendant asbestos companies. Your lawyer will use the information gathered during this process to help you reach an equitable settlement.

Your mesothelioma lawyers will prepare for a trial if the lawsuit is not able to be settled through negotiation. They will put together a solid case using the most comprehensive evidence and a thorough knowledge of your specific situation. They will fight to secure you the compensation you are entitled to.
